Imagine if you found the real one.After a string of nightmare relationships, Emily's had it with modern-day men. She'd rather pour herself a glass of wine and curl up with Pride and Prejudice and her beloved Mr Darcy. So what if he’s a fictional hero?Faced with spending New Year’s at yet another singles party, she books herself on a coach tour of Jane Austen country, but quickly realises she won't find her dream man here - just a coach full of pensioners and one particularly aggravating (if handsome) journalist, Spike.That's until she enters a room and finds herself face-to-face with none other than Darcy himself. The actual, real Mr Darcy. From the book.
